About The Role And Team
Uber is building the next generation of its logistics platform: the systems that move physical packages across a regional carrier network, from the first pickup to the final doorstep.
This spans middle-mile linehaul between hubs, sortation and cross-dock operations inside those hubs, and the last-mile delivery that puts a package in a customer's hands.
Uber Direct is among the fastest-growing products in the B2C (Business-to-Consumer) delivery spaces.
It lets merchants create deliveries through our Dashboard or by integrating directly with our public API, adding delivery to their own website or app.
We are now extending these capabilities into a full package-logistics network.
This is a rare opportunity to build a foundational platform close to the ground floor.
You'll design and own the core systems that track the custody of every package as it changes hands across the network - services meant to run Uber's logistics operations for the next decade, built on Uber's world-class infrastructure and handling millions of physical events a day.
